SUMMARY Christopher Awdry is in many ways responsible for the creation of Thomas and his railway, which started as a story told to him by his father during a bout of measles in 1942 . By the time of his father's death in 1997 , Awdry had added a further 14 books to the series, as well as writing stories for several Thomas The Tank Engine And Friends Annuals . In 2001 Christopher Awdry wrote six stories featured in two books concerning railway safety, which were distributed to every primary school and library in the country. The train operator Virgin Trains produced a colouring book for young passengers based on the stories. A series of six books has been produced featuring locomotives from the Eastbourne Miniature Steam Railway , and illustrated by Marc Vyvyan-Jones. Awdry is currently campaigning to have the original series of books reprinted in their original form. WORKS Railway Series Volumes
